Output 64109ecf320bf860b9c65eefd7ab0a7e9b89ea37503f184581659e99fdf905fe:1

value
153065000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63c6e16cfa78b29789feaeb6903b4978e189fc07 OP_EQUAL
address
A1XqoqyLHuXgBkBfo2CR2Cg4jqenZuCYkz
transaction
64109ecf320bf860b9c65eefd7ab0a7e9b89ea37503f184581659e99fdf905fe